Hyaluronic acid (HA) is a naturally occurring substance in the human body that is essential to skin elasticity, moisture, and overall skin health. HA is predominantly distributed throughout the skin, eyes, connective, and synovial tissue. HA is used by the body to provide hydration, skeletal support, and is involved in the body’s own healing process.
HA has long chain sugars that are called glycosaminoglycans, which can draw large amounts of water and is therefore an effective hydrator. In skin, the ability of HA to draw moisture keeps skin plump, smooth, and hydrated. The global market for cosmeceuticals with HA has grown remarkably over the past several years as consumers have become increasingly aware of the effects of HA for skincare. As a commonly marketed component in high-end skincare formulations, HA is now seen as a staple in hydrating, anti-aging, and wrinkle-reducing skincare formulations, reflecting the growing importance of cosmeceutical ingredient development and formulation.[2]
The worldwide market for HA-based skincare products is growing at an accelerating pace. Fuelling this growth is increasing consumer understanding of skin health and hydration.
